Safras avaliadas

  • 201588 pts

    Pale and refreshing, this is lightly scented by orange blossoms and strawberries, with similar flavors following. It's a splendid sipping wine, with plenty of acid to buoy up the light fruit.

  • 201288 pts

    Done in a clean, quaffable style, this brings a mix of beet root, sassafras, amaro and brown sugar flavors into play, with a round, pleasantly fruity midpalate. It's a country wine, great for glugging.
